2. I Check the Compatibility First
The first thing I look at is compatibility. Not every laptop card reader supports every SD format. I make sure the reader works with:
- SD cards
- SDHC cards
- SDXC cards
- microSD cards, if I need them
I also check whether my laptop has a built-in reader or if I need an external USB reader. If I use newer high-capacity cards, I make sure the reader supports them properly.
3. I Pay Attention to Speed
Speed matters a lot to me, especially when I move large photo or video files. I look for a reader that supports fast transfer rates so I do not waste time waiting. If I work with 4K video or burst-mode photography, I prefer a reader with USB 3.0, USB 3.1, or USB-C support for better performance.

5. I Look for Easy Plug-and-Play Use
I like a reader that works right away without installing drivers. Plug-and-play functionality makes my life easier, especially when I switch between devices. If I can connect it and start transferring files immediately, that is a big plus for me.
6. I Consider the Port Type
The connection type is important because it affects convenience and speed. I usually choose based on my laptop’s available ports:
- USB-A: Good for older laptops
- USB-C: Better for newer laptops and faster transfer
- Built-in slot: Convenient if my laptop already has one
I make sure the reader matches my laptop so I do not need unnecessary adapters.
